If assignment latency exceeds 250ms for five consecutive minutes, or bucket skew passes 3%, do not restart the service yourself — stale assignments can contaminate running experiments. First, page the Bucketwise primary via the rotation board and note the affected experiment IDs in the incident channel. If the primary does not acknowledge within fifteen minutes, escalate to the Experimentation Platform lead at Quillford Labs. For anything touching revenue experiments, escalate immediately and send a summary to the address below.

escalation mailbox, yafog-kafof: eliok@xolmarcloud.local

## Break-Glass: Formula Sandbox Escape Hatch

Heads up, plugin authors — user-supplied formulas in GridForge run inside the Tidewell sandbox, and normally you can't touch it. But if the sandbox wedges and your plugin's formulas all return errors, there's a break-glass path to restart the evaluator. Use it sparingly; every invocation is audited. The restart console prompts for the recovery passphrase listed below.

vault phrase of kawef-yahop = wenir-jorox-druys-belion-kelion-lamvan-frawyn-norael-julox-raleth-rusax-oliys-holael

When the Ferngate schema migration is mid-flight, account recovery flows read from both the legacy and expanded tables. Always run the expand phase first, backfill with the Larchbend worker, then contract only after dual-reads show parity for 24 hours. Never drop columns while recovery traffic is live. If a recovery request fails during the dual-write window, re-drive it through the reconciliation console; the console unlocks with the recovery passphrase given directly below this line.

strongbox words: norwyn-wenael-aldvan-aldiel-wendor-holael